There
are five main challenges in marketing a
business:
1.
Getting the attention of prospective
clients.
2.
Giving them enough information to interest them
in exploring working with you.
3.
Turning that interest into a commitment to work
with you.
4.
Negotiating the terms of doing business so that
you make a decent profit
5.
Serving clients so that they both return and
send you referrals.

With
Marketing Mentoring we use the "7-Step Fast Track
Model"
This
proven methodology was developed by Robert
Middleton and has been used successful with
thousands of self-employed professionals and
professional service businesses.
1.
Marketing Ball -
The Game of Marketing
The
first thing you need to understand is how the
game of marketing is played - and won.
Successful marketing is not a random set of
activities; it has an underlying structure and
set of rules you must follow to be successful.
When you understand the game you can finally
start to play it with some confidence.
2.
Marketing Mindset -
The Inner Game of Marketing
How
you think about marketing your business is a big
key to success. If you are avoiding
marketing, afraid to implement marketing plans
or just plain confused about what to do next,
you need to change your current marketing
mindset to be successful. The good news is that
it's easier than you think.
3.
Marketing Syntax
- The Language of Marketing
Most
people don't realize that marketing has a
language. If you use the right language, you
generate attention and interest. If you use the
wrong language, your prospects won't pay
attention to you. It's absolutely necessary that
all your marketing messages and communications
adhere to the language of marketing.
4.
Core Marketing
Message
- The Value of Marketing
Your
first important step in marketing is to create a
marketing message that speaks to the needs and
desires of your clients. When you have such
a message, you have created a foundation that
will be utilized in all your marketing. A great
marketing message tells the prospect what's in
it for them to do business with you.
5.
Marketing
Information
- The Currency of Marketing
Once
you have the attention and interest of a
prospect, the next thing they want is more
information. We call marketing information
"currency," because it actually buys you
attention, time, credibility and trust.
Marketing information includes everything from
your business card to your web site.
6.
Marketing
Strategies
- The How-To of Marketing
Once
you have the foundation of your marketing
message and information, it's time to implement
some marketing strategies. Strategies
include everything from networking to speaking
to mailings to publishing. You need to develop
and implement the most appropriate and effective
marketing strategies for your business.
7.
Marketing Action
Plans
- The Structure of Marketing
Your
final marketing step is developing a very
detailed marketing action plan or plans.
It's not enough to know the strategies you are
going to use, you need to map them out like a
blueprint with very specific objectives and
action steps. Once you have a solid plan, you
are well on your way to attracting all the
business you need.
